6.80 RC6 - Maybe memory leak?

PostPosted: Fri Mar 09, 2018 1:43 pm
by Calahan
Just got a memory warning from Windows 7 (64bit), I have to close Newsbin.
My PC has 32 GB memory and that never happened before...
I looked in the Taskmanager, added memory colums and saw that Newsbin used over 11 GB.

I've done nothing special before. Auto download is active for 2 groups and those two groups were loaded (in tabs, only with header from the last 30 days).
After a restart of Newsbin all was ok. Maybe a memory leak somewhere?

Just got back home. Newsbin was running about 8 hours and again all memory was used.
I used Process Explorer to get more info about the Newsbin process. Here's the result:
Code: Select all
Virtual Memory:
Virtual Memory:
Private Bytes       16,789,036 K
Peak Private Bytes  16,821,888 K
Virtual Size        20,346,960 K
Page Faults           26,703,246
Page Fault Delta             880

Physical Memory:
Working Set         12,228,448 K
   WS Private       12,203,928 K
   WS Sharable          24,484 K
   WS Shared            17,276 K
Peak Working Set    12,259,312 K

Handles       630
Peak Handles  949
GDI Handles   295
USER Handles  184
Hope this helps. I have to go back to RC2 until the problems are solved.

Re: 6.80 RC6 - Maybe memory leak?

PostPosted: Tue Mar 13, 2018 12:04 pm
by Calahan
Didn't change anything. I only installed RC2 over RC6 and got no more "out of memory" messages. Newsbin uses about 3 GB and all is ok.
No answer to my post so far, so am I the only one who got that problem? Maybe it has to do with my auto download setup?

I really want to use $(RAWSUBJECT). I think it could be fixed in RC7, but I don't want to have memory problems with RC7 again (or in later versions).
So any update?

Re: 6.80 RC6 - Maybe memory leak?

PostPosted: Tue Mar 13, 2018 12:07 pm
by Quade
RAW Subject is broken in RC6. I saw your message. I was sorta waiting for others to chime in.

Re: 6.80 RC6 - Maybe memory leak?

PostPosted: Tue Mar 13, 2018 2:08 pm
by dexter
If you have open post lists for groups set to auto-download, Newsbin will definitely creep up in memory usage. With each incremental header download, they'll get loaded into the post list for the group. If you happen to be monitoring a group that just received a spam flood, I can see it consuming all your memory. Do you recall how many posts were being displayed in the post list tabs when you noticed it was consuming 11GB of RAM?

Since nobody else is reporting a memory leak, I'm guessing this is the cause of your high memory usage.

Re: 6.80 RC6 - Maybe memory leak?

PostPosted: Wed Mar 14, 2018 3:26 pm
by Calahan
No spam flood in the group
The post list tab for the group(s) shows 30 days.
The first group shows 329 lines, there are 196 sets (15 to 210 files per set).
Second group shows 74 lines, there are 63 sets (12 to 140 files per set).
The first group gets about 5-15 sets per day.
I don't change anything. I install the software, get memory problems (tried two times), install another version of Newsbin and no memory problem.
So I would bet, it's the Newsbin version, who has a bug.

By the way , had to go back from RC2 to B11 yesterday, because RC2 was hanging (again like RC5).
6 downloaded sets were hanging with blue lines (nearly) complete but no other download and no unpacking, header queue in the status bar showed (0).
On the other side, RC5 had hanging incomplete downloads, whereas RC2 hang and didn't unpack.

I had to restart Newsbin and Newsbin began to download the downloaded files again, instead of using the downloaded (correct, checked with Multipar) files.
It seems instead of making the program better for a release, it gets worse and worse with every RC. (Sorry to say that.)
I couldn't use the tried RC2, RC5 and RC6. B11 is running now without problems, again.

Re: 6.80 RC6 - Maybe memory leak?

PostPosted: Wed Mar 14, 2018 4:28 pm
by dexter
We aren't seeing these issues here so we'll need to wait for more people to report the same problems so we can determine some commonality. Usually odd issues like this point to a software conflict with some security software that hooks in and monitors Newsbin's activity. Large memory use could be attributed to Newsbin in task manager when it is actually being consumed by some kernel level driver belonging to antivirus software for example. To test this, you could temporarily disable any security software, reboot your machine (required to get the kernel drivers out of memory), then see if you can recreate the issues you are seeing with RC6. We do have an RC7 in the wings but it doesn't have any changes that may address the things you have been reporting.

I know you'll say that older versions work for you but it could be that your security software was set to ignore the older version. The newer versions would look like a different program to security software.

Re: 6.80 RC6 - Maybe memory leak?

PostPosted: Wed Mar 14, 2018 9:40 pm
by Calahan
I use Windows 7 Ultimate, 64 bit, Service Pack 1 and F-Secure for Antivirus and Firewall.
F-Secure opens a popup, if there is no rule for a new program (-version) and I have to decide what it should do.
So I don't think it's my Antivirus/Firewall, but I'll try it again without it.

Re: 6.80 RC6 - Maybe memory leak?

PostPosted: Mon Mar 19, 2018 6:44 am
by Calahan
I changed nothing on my system and tried RC7 now for two days.
No memory usage above 4 GB so far. It seems it was a hick-up in RC6.